What’s better than a top-rated, liberal arts college education? Getting one for free, of course. Though it’s impossible to go online and simply sign up for a full degree-eligible number of courses at one of these schools, some schools have made it possible to take one or two courses online completely free of charge. Whether you’re still in school, recently graduated or haven’t opened a textbook in decades, the desire to learn more about the subjects that interest you doesn’t always have to come at a steep price. Maybe you’ve always been interested in social psychology, or had a desire to learn coding one day in the future. With these (highly credible) and easy options available remotely and for free, it’s time to stop putting off expanding your academic portfolio to some day in the future and start hitting the books today.
